Output 85f57899ef6e7fbf3c4cb0f99feb59b7fa3d4fe2c366947d62e4cf5c0dca8e24:0

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c989ddd0da3056b5c5c0cba66e7217f082c5eb2e OP_EQUAL
address
3L4euEQ3QE9oveiFuUNK5MQZfEwjoPpT7o
transaction
85f57899ef6e7fbf3c4cb0f99feb59b7fa3d4fe2c366947d62e4cf5c0dca8e24
spent
true